Niños del Lago Mission

Our Niños del Lago program is designed to help transform the lives of Guatemala’s neediest children by providing an educational and mentoring experience in an inspirational setting where they can relax and imagine a life beyond poverty.

Goals

Encourage at-risk children to stay in school

Enhance self-esteem

Develop resiliency

How will the program work?

The program provides one trained Guatemalan university student as camp counselor to every six children.

Children are invited to return year afteryear, giving them an additional incentive tofocus on education and stay in school.

• Ecology & nature• Theatre, art, dance• Cooking• Hiking, boating• Team sports• Group celebrations & storytelling• Rewards

Our Service Partners

• Orphanages, rural schools for indigenous youth, and other private organizations throughout Guatemala who provide shelter and education for the poorest children.

• Niños del Lago supplements and strengthens the work of other child welfare organizations.
